All About Latest BTC News

SEO Agency vs. DIY SEO - What Works Best for Small Businesses?

Mar 24

SEO Agency vs. DIY SEO - What Works Best for Small Businesses?

SEO can significantly impact your small business's online visibility and growth. Choosing between hiring an SEO agency or opting for DIY SEO can be daunting. While an agency brings expertise and resources to the table, doing it yourself might save you money but can be risky if you're not well-versed in the latest trends and algorithms. In this post, we will explore the benefits and drawbacks of each option to help you make an informed decision tailored to your specific needs.

Key Takeaways:

  • Hiring an SEO agency can provide access to specialised expertise and advanced tools that may significantly enhance a small business’s online visibility.
  • DIY SEO can be a cost-effective option for small businesses with limited budgets, allowing owners to learn and implement strategies independently.
  • The effectiveness of either approach depends on the specific needs, goals, and resources available to the small business, highlighting the importance of assessing individual circumstances.

Understanding SEO

For small businesses, grasping the fundamentals of SEO can significantly enhance your online presence. Search Engine Optimisation (SEO) is a collection of strategies aimed at improving a website's visibility on search engines, ultimately leading to increased traffic and potential sales. By optimising your website’s content, structure, and technical aspects, you create a pathway for your target audience to discover your offerings more easily.

What is SEO?

Understanding SEO involves recognising it as a technique used to improve your website’s ranking on search engine results pages (SERPs). This encompasses various practices, including keyword research, content creation, link building, and improving site speed. All these factors work together to signal search engines about the relevance and quality of your site.

Importance of SEO for Small Businesses

Above all, SEO is vital for small businesses as it increases your brand's visibility and drives organic traffic to your website. A strong SEO strategy enables you to reach potential customers effectively, allowing you to compete with larger businesses. By ranking higher on search results, you enhance credibility and attract users who are actively searching for your products or services.

Hence, investing in SEO can transform your business’s online success by ensuring that potential customers can easily find you. An effective SEO strategy can lead to higher website traffic, improved brand recognition, and increased sales. Ignoring SEO means risking your visibility among competitors and missing out on chances to engage with your audience. A well-implemented SEO approach helps you to optimise your resources and can deliver long-term growth and sustainability for your business.

Benefits of Hiring an SEO Agency

Some small businesses find that partnering with an SEO agency offers considerable advantages. By leveraging expert knowledge and resources, you can significantly enhance your online visibility and drive targeted traffic to your website. Additionally, agencies often provide tailored strategies that can adapt to your unique business needs, freeing up your time to focus on other critical aspects of your operations.

Expertise and Experience

Above all, SEO agencies bring a wealth of knowledge to the table. With professionals who are well-versed in the latest trends, algorithm updates, and best practices, you gain access to strategies that enhance performance and drive results. Their extensive experience means they can quickly identify what works best for your specific niche, ensuring a competitive edge.

Access to Advanced Tools

Before engaging an SEO agency, you'll discover they utilise advanced tools that can analyse your website's performance far beyond basic metrics. These tools can identify opportunities for improvement, track your competitors, and provide insights that inform your SEO strategy, leading to more effective decision-making.

Considering hiring an SEO agency means you will benefit from technology that enhances your marketing efforts:

  1. Comprehensive keyword research
  2. Website audits for performance optimisation
  3. Analytics to track progress and adjust strategies
  4. Competitive analysis tools to understand market positioning

Advanced SEO Tools and Their Functions

Tool Function
SEMrush Keyword research and competitor analysis
Ahrefs Backlink tracking and market analysis
Google Analytics Traffic monitoring and user behaviour analysis
Moz SEO insights and performance tracking

Do-It-Yourself SEO Advantages

Many small business owners find Do-It-Yourself (DIY) SEO appealing due to its flexibility and the opportunity to learn. By taking control of your SEO efforts, you can adapt strategies to suit your unique business needs and goals, ensuring a tailored approach to online visibility. Additionally, you can implement changes and monitor progress in real-time, making it easier to identify what works for your audience.

Cost Savings

Below, you can save a significant amount of money by opting for DIY SEO over hiring an agency. While agencies typically charge a premium for their expertise and services, you can allocate your funds towards tools and resources that will help you effectively manage your own SEO efforts without breaking the bank.

Control Over Strategy

Before you probe DIY SEO, it's important to acknowledge the benefit of having complete control over your strategy. This autonomy allows you to tailor every aspect of your SEO initiatives to align with your business objectives. A strong, well-informed strategy empowers you to adjust tactics based on performance data and industry trends, ensuring you’re always moving in the right direction. However, be cautious to avoid making impulsive changes based on short-term results; a consistent, measured approach is necessary for long-lasting success.

Challenges of Working with an SEO Agency

To engage an SEO agency can present several challenges that small businesses must navigate. You may find that aligning your vision with the agency's approach requires time and strategy. Additionally, dependencies on external teams can sometimes slow down decision-making processes, impacting your overall marketing efforts.

Cost Considerations

With hiring an SEO agency comes a range of costs that may vary significantly. You need to assess whether the investment aligns with your budget and expectations for return on investment. While some agencies offer competitive rates, others may charge premium fees for comprehensive services, making it vital for you to do thorough research.

Communication Issues

Besides cost, communication issues can pose significant challenges when working with an SEO agency. Misunderstandings regarding project goals or expectations may arise, leading to frustrations on both sides.

Further, establishing effective communication channels is vital for a successful partnership. You should ensure that your agency understands your business objectives and targets. Regular updates and feedback sessions can help mitigate any misunderstandings. Poor communication may result in missed opportunities and unmet expectations, emphasising the importance of a proactive approach to keeping lines of dialogue open.

Common DIY SEO Pitfalls

After begining on your DIY SEO journey, you may encounter several common pitfalls that could hinder your success. Understanding these challenges will help you navigate the path more effectively and make the most of your efforts. From inadequate knowledge to time constraints, these obstacles can compromise your ability to achieve impactful results. Being aware of them will enable you to adopt strategies that keep you on the right track.

Lack of Knowledge

To effectively optimise your website for search engines, a solid understanding of SEO principles is important. If you overlook this aspect, you risk using outdated or ineffective techniques, which can undermine your visibility. Keeping up with the ever-evolving SEO landscape is vital for spotting opportunities and avoiding potential loopholes.

Time Constraints

Along your journey of implementing DIY SEO, you may find that time constraints can significantly affect your ability to execute effective strategies. SEO requires a dedicated commitment to ongoing research and optimisation efforts—something many small business owners struggle to balance with their existing responsibilities. Neglecting important activities can result in missed opportunities for growth.

With limited time, you may find yourself rushing through tasks or overlooking opportunities for optimisation that could elevate your website’s performance. This can lead to a haphazard approach, which not only diminishes your chances of ranking higher but could also result in wasted resources. Being proactive in managing your time and setting specific goals will help ensure that you dedicate enough time to vital SEO activities, ultimately benefiting your small business in the long run.

Making the Right Choice for Your Business

All small businesses must weigh the advantages and disadvantages of hiring an SEO agency against managing SEO independently. Your specific circumstances, including your goals, expertise, and resources, will guide you in making a choice that aligns with your business strategy. Evaluating these factors will help ensure you select the best route to enhance your online presence.

Assessing Your Needs

To make an informed decision, you need to assess your specific needs regarding SEO. Consider the type of competition in your industry and the complexity of your website. Determine whether you require comprehensive services or if you can handle certain aspects of SEO in-house. This evaluation will direct your choice, ensuring it complements your overall business objectives.

Budget Considerations

Your budget plays a significant role in deciding between an SEO agency and DIY SEO. Understanding how much you can invest in SEO services is crucial to achieving your online marketing goals.

But keep in mind that while opting for an SEO agency can be a more significant initial expense, it often provides valuable expertise and time savings. Investing in professional services can yield quicker results and better rankings, which are vital for your business's growth. Conversely, with DIY SEO, your financial commitment might be lower, but the learning curve and potential for ineffective strategies could hinder progress. Assess what works best for your scenario, as poor choices can be dangerous for your online visibility.

Final Words

Presently, when deciding between an SEO agency and DIY SEO for your small business, consider your resources, expertise, and long-term goals. While an agency can provide professional insights and save you time, DIY SEO allows for greater control and potential cost savings. Evaluate your capabilities and willingness to invest in learning SEO best practices. Ultimately, the right choice depends on your unique situation, but with dedication, both paths can lead to success in enhancing your online presence.

FAQ

Q: What are the main advantages of hiring an SEO agency for my small business?

A: One of the primary advantages of hiring an SEO agency is their expertise and experience. SEO agencies typically employ professionals who are well-versed in the latest SEO trends, techniques, and algorithm changes. They can provide a tailored strategy for your business that considers your specific market and competition. Additionally, SEO agencies have access to advanced tools and resources that can enhance the effectiveness of their strategies, save you time, and deliver results more efficiently compared to handling SEO on your own.

Q: What are the potential benefits of pursuing DIY SEO for my small business?

A: Engaging in DIY SEO can be beneficial for small businesses with limited budgets. It allows business owners to gain a deeper understanding of their online presence and how search engines work. Furthermore, by dedicating time to learning SEO techniques, you can make immediate changes to your website and content at little to no cost. Additionally, DIY SEO enables you to maintain full control over your strategies, allowing for direct implementation of your ideas and adjustments based on real-time results.

Q: How do I determine which approach—hiring an SEO agency or DIY SEO—is right for my small business?

A: The decision between hiring an SEO agency or opting for DIY SEO depends largely on your business's specific circumstances, including budget, time availability, and SEO knowledge. If your budget allows for professional assistance and you lack the time or expertise to manage SEO effectively, an SEO agency might be the best choice. On the other hand, if you have a limited budget, sufficient time to invest in learning, and a willingness to experiment with SEO strategies, a DIY approach could work well. It may also be useful to start with basic DIY practices and then consider professional help as your business grows.